Race Report
Coniston Country Fair Fell Race | Coniston, Cumbria | 6 Miles | 2400 ft |
Sunday 19th July 2009
It is a classic up and down fell race from the show field, in a glorious setting at Coniston Hall, on the shores of Coniston Lake, not far from Donald Campbell’s fateful crash site.
A crowd of over 2,000+ visitors to the country fair got the adrenalin of the runners going, with the start taking place in the main arena and the runners exiting via a race funnel through the crowds of onlookers, then away onto the fell crossing the Walna Scar track and then on to the top of Coniston Old Man and back.
The weather was bright and breezy perfect for fell running
Alistair Dunn of Helm Hill won for the third time in a time of 53mins 25secs (slower than his record winning time in 2006 of 52.36), with Ben Abdelnoor (Ambleside) a close second in 53.43, with Mark Addison (Helm Hill) third in 55.46
First lady home in 15th place overall was Lisa Lacon( Holmfirth) a previous winner of the lady’s race in a time of 66.23, with the second lady/1st lady Vet 40 Kendra White ( Esk Valley) and 3rd lady S. Pike.
Helm Hill again won the team having four of the first five finishers.
1st MV40 was Paul Brittleton, 1st MV50 was Billy Proctor and 1st MV60 was Patric Gilchrist.
Celebrity runners included our local MP Tim Farron who finished in a respectable time of 89.15 beating his previous record and still had enough energy left to present the prizes.
Coniston Country Fair provides an excellent setting for the fell race and a very enjoyable family day out with plenty to do and see, including Herd wick sheep show, Cumberland and Westmoreland wrestling, craft marquee, children’s sports, ferret racing, terrier racing, demonstration of local crafts, stick show, hound and terrier show, pet show, over 70 trade stands, side shows and refreshments.
Last but not least was the beer tent which was still going strong many hours after the fell race ended. The runners deserved it!
